EVENT | LANDFALL | IOA ELANAG MINGLE LOG
Characters: ALL!
Date: October 20th - ongoing
Location: Ioa Elanag
Situation: Tu Vishan has come to a rest at the edge of a previously unexplored continent.
Warnings/Rating: Add warnings as needed.


The empty coastline and rocky beach they disembark to seems untouched, and fish school plentifully in the shallows without fear, something that the kedan are quick to take advantage of.
Once they move away from the shoreline, the landscape quickly turns to savannah scrubland, the arid sand a deep ochre colour. The grasses that grow there are thin and spindly, adapted to what appears to be a lack of water. Although the temperature is cool -- though not cold, despite the lateness of the month in a northern hemisphere -- it would be easy to extrapolate that it would be extremely dry and hot in the summer months.
Like the schools of fish, the wildlife here seem untroubled by the presence of newcomers, unless overtly threatening moves are made toward them. In addition to a host of different types of birds -- which all seem to be hunting each other, and openly cannibalistic -- there are a few types of species which become familiar sights to explorers.
---
Some three miles inland, well within the range that Tu Vishan's protective aura extends to power the soul gems, a city stands quietly, surrounded by a massive wooden stockade. There are no roads or trails which lead to it, as if the city was simply dropped from the sky. This wall is hewn from logs larger than most have ever seen in their lives -- easily as big as the oldest redwoods or sequoias on earth, and many larger even than that.
They've all been cut precisely, ingeniously locked together so that no bindings or fillings have needed to be used to hold it together. Certainly, they're nothing like the scraggly, bent things seem to be growing in the area, which are only deemed trees by virtue of being marginally taller than bushes. The height of the wall is easily fifty feet, encompassing a square area of approximately a mile on each side, and there is one gate which is closed, but not locked, and is in impeccable shape.

LOCAL WILDLIFE ENCOUNTERS
The first, which is what the kedan claim to be the most notable thing about Ioa Elanag are, in fact, rabbits. These creatures are about the size of a cat, and have appendages which resemble wings along the sides of their bodies, although they cannot seem to fly with them. They're pale white with dark spotting across their coats, which given the landscape colour scheme, doesn't seem like it would lend itself well to the species' ability to survive. They are herbivores, and although they appear to be on the dumb prey side, they'll become easily docile if offered food.
Munga (image)
The second type of common wildlife is a spiny lizard about the size of a rat, who are very aggressive, venomous, and good at camouflage... not a good combination for anyone who happens to be walking by. In fact, they'll even charge at passing legs and feet, regardless of how large or intimidating the opponent is! Their spines secrete a toxin that causes a variety of symptoms, everything from mild hallucinations to an extreme sensitivity to light, sound, or smell. They are carnivores and prey mostly on the small rabbit-like creatures, using their venom to disorient their prey until they end up keeling over in the dirt.
Aphaufa (image)
The largest of the local wildlife are hulking creatures larger than elephants and which typically roam in herds of 5-10 individuals. They are omnivores, although grazing on the shaggy grasses seem to make up the bulk of their diet. Should they come across the rabbit creatures, whether living or dead, they'll eat those too! They are supremely unimpressed by the new visitors, and will generally move off if approached... but will wheel and charge if provoked. With a thick hide and stocky build vaguely reminiscent of a woolly bison, even blades and bullets can be turned aside. They don't seem inclined to be troublesome, but they're not something you want to be on the receiving end of.
